#eecbc4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eecbc4 is composed of 93.3% red, 79.6%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.7% magenta, 17.6%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 10 degrees, a saturation of 55.3% and a lightness of 85.1%. #eecbc4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#dd9789.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

● #eecbc4 color description : Light grayish red.
#eecbc4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eecbc4 has RGB values of R:238, G:203,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.15, Y:0.18,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15649732.
